Disparities in cancer clinical trials among low‐ and middle‐income countries: A 20‐year analysis

open access: yesCancer, Volume 131, Issue 21, 1 November 2025.
Abstract Background There are suspected disparities in clinical research (CR) development among low‐ and middle‐income countries (LMICs). This study investigated differences in number and complexity of clinical trials (CTs) and how economic growth (EG) might contribute to these disparities.

Development of the United States GReenhouse Gas and Air Pollutants Emissions System (GRA2PES)

open access: yesJournal of Geophysical Research: Atmospheres, Volume 130, Issue 20, 28 October 2025.
Abstract In the U.S., emissions of greenhouse gases and air pollutants are often developed independently. Here, we describe the GReenhouse gas And Air Pollutants Emissions System (GRA2PES), which provides gridded emissions of fossil‐fuel carbon dioxide (ffCO2) and 93 air quality (AQ) species for 17 combustion and non‐combustion sectors at 4 km × 4 km ...
